- Hollywood Premiere Night: Roll out the red carpet! Think paparazzi (friends with cameras), mock interviews, and maybe even a best-dressed award. Encourage guests to dress to the nines, and get ready for some glamorous content creation opportunities. Set up a backdrop with the couple's names and engagement date for that perfect red-carpet photo op. Make sure to have plenty of sparkling drinks and gourmet snacks to keep the VIPs happy.
- Masquerade Ball: A little mystery, a lot of elegance. Masks add an air of intrigue and make for stunning photos. Plus, everyone loves an excuse to dress up in their finest attire. Dim the lights, play some enchanting music, and let the magic unfold. Consider having a mask-making station where guests can customize their own masks, adding a creative touch to the event. Hire a professional photographer to capture the elegance and mystery of the night.
- Tropical Getaway: Bring the beach vibes to the party! Think vibrant colors, tiki torches, and fruity cocktails. Encourage guests to wear Hawaiian shirts and leis, and get ready for some fun in the sun (or at least the illusion of sun!). Set up a DIY cocktail bar where guests can mix their own tropical concoctions. Play some reggae music and let the good times roll. Don't forget the sunscreen (just kidding… mostly!).
- Enchanted Forest: Transform the venue into a magical woodland with fairy lights, lush greenery, and whimsical decorations. Encourage guests to dress as their favorite mythical creatures. This theme is perfect for couples who love fantasy, nature, and a touch of whimsy. Set up a photo booth with props like fairy wings, flower crowns, and wands. Hire a face painter to create magical looks for the guests. Serve woodland-themed snacks like mushroom tarts and berry skewers.
- Roaring Twenties: Transport everyone back to the Jazz Age with flapper dresses, fedoras, and art deco decorations. This theme is all about glitz, glamour, and good times. Hire a jazz band to set the mood, and get ready to Charleston the night away. Serve classic cocktails like Gin Rickeys and Sidecars. Set up a casino-style game area with poker and roulette for added entertainment. Encourage guests to use vintage slang to add to the authenticity of the theme.

- Art Gallery: A chic, modern space that oozes creativity. The artwork on display can serve as a built-in conversation starter. Plus, the blank walls are perfect for projecting images or videos. Just make sure to check the gallery's rules about food, drinks, and decorations.
- Loft Space: Industrial-chic with exposed brick and high ceilings. These spaces are super versatile and can be transformed to fit any theme. They often have great natural light, which is a plus for photos and videos. Be sure to check the acoustics, as lofts can sometimes be echoey.
- Rooftop Terrace: Stunning city views and a built-in party atmosphere. This is a great option for a more intimate gathering. Decorate with string lights, candles, and comfortable seating. Just be sure to have a backup plan in case of bad weather.
- Botanical Garden: Lush greenery and natural beauty. This is a perfect option for a romantic and whimsical theme. Decorate with flowers, lanterns, and fairy lights. Be sure to check the garden's rules about decorations and noise levels.
- Brewery or Distillery: A unique and trendy option for couples who love craft beer or spirits. The industrial setting provides a cool backdrop for the party. Serve signature cocktails or beer flights to match the theme. Just be sure to have plenty of non-alcoholic options as well.

Brainstorming Themes & Concepts
When planning a content creator engagement party, think about what makes the couple unique. What are their passions? What kind of content do they create? Use these questions as your compass to navigate the theme of the party. If they are travel bloggers, a travel-themed party with decorations from around the world would be perfect. If they are gamers, transform the venue into a retro arcade or a futuristic gaming lounge. Remember, the more personalized the theme, the more memorable the party will be.
